Visit your dentist frequently. If you do, it will be easy to thwart minor and severe oral diseases. At the same time, choose a diet that is ideal for the health of your body and teeth. Be careful since it is vital to maintain healthy teeth.
By going to a dental expert, you are preempting sever gum maladies which is one of the main reasons for tooth loss among grown-ups in many countries. Periodontal disease can affect oral conditions negatively. It can destroy not only your gums but the teeth as well. You can suffer unbearable pain and other conditions such as bone loss. As a matter of fact, gum infections have been associated with multiple universal illnesses which include cancer of the pancreas, diabetes, and lung sickness.
